Janet Holden And Eric McCormack’s Divorce: What Happened
In November 2024, court documents revealed that Janet Holden had filed for divorce from Will & Grace actor Eric McCormack after more than 26 years together. The filing, submitted to Los Angeles County Superior Court on November 22, cited “irreconcilable differences” as the reason for their separation. While no date of separation was listed, the filing made it clear that Holden was seeking spousal support and also requested that the court terminate McCormack’s ability to seek support from her.
The couple, who shared a long and seemingly steady relationship, had not publicly addressed the split at the time of the filing. Their separation surprised fans who had come to see them as one of Hollywood’s more enduring and grounded pairs. How Janet Holden And Eric McCormack First Met
Janet Holden and Eric McCormack’s story began in 1994, on the set of the CBS television series Lonesome Dove: The Outlaw Years. McCormack portrayed Colonel Francis Clay Mosby, while Holden worked as an assistant director on the show. It was a professional environment that didn’t easily allow for personal connections, but their chemistry was undeniable.
In a 2007 essay for The Guardian, McCormack shared that their relationship began as a secret romance. “We had a secret affair the first season,” he wrote, explaining that Holden was hesitant to get involved with an actor because of the potential professional complications. She had a reputation for being disciplined and dedicated, and dating a cast member could have jeopardized that. But McCormack’s persistence eventually won her over, and the connection they formed turned into a lasting partnership that would span more than two decades.
A Look Back: 26 Years Of Marriage
Eric McCormack and Janet Holden married in August 1997, just months before McCormack landed the role that would make him a household name—Will Truman in Will & Grace. The timing of their marriage turned out to be crucial, as McCormack later credited Holden with helping him stay balanced amid the whirlwind of fame that followed.
Throughout their 26 years together, the couple maintained a strong commitment to privacy. They made public appearances occasionally but rarely shared details about their personal life. Together, they raised their son, Finnigan Holden McCormack, born in 2002, and created a family life that stayed largely away from Hollywood’s constant glare. Inside Their Relationship: What Eric McCormack Said About Janet
Eric McCormack has often spoken with affection and gratitude when describing his relationship with Janet Holden. In interviews, he credited her with keeping him grounded, especially during his rise to stardom in the late 1990s and early 2000s. “I think I conducted myself as a much better human being because I was already married when all that came along,” McCormack once said, referring to the early days of Will & Grace.
In The Guardian essay, McCormack described Holden as strong, independent, and refreshingly down-to-earth. He admired that she wore jeans, drove a pickup truck, and preferred authenticity over glamour. Her resistance to Hollywood’s excess and her ability to maintain normalcy helped the actor navigate fame with humility. Their relationship was built on mutual respect and understanding, qualities that McCormack often said made their marriage so lasting.
